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) have faced a tough time in IPL 2025, with most of their fast bowlers ruled out due to injuries. However, this has given young players a chance to prove themselves. One such youngster is Prince Yadav, who made an impact by taking his maiden IPL wicket. His first victim was none other than the dangerous Australian batter, Travis Head.
Travis Head, who had already survived two lifelines in Ravi Bishnoi’s over, was finally dismissed in the eighth over. On the third ball of the over, Prince Yadav bowled a brilliant delivery that shattered Head’s stumps. The 23-year-old bowler’s celebration was filled with emotion as he removed one of the most aggressive batters in the tournament.

Notably, Prince Yadav had played in LSG’s first match but couldn’t take a wicket and conceded 47 runs. However, the potential he has shown in this game suggests that LSG will continue to back him in upcoming matches. At the time of writing, SRH had scored 110 runs for the loss of four wickets in 12 overs.
